XML 55 R110.htm IDEA: XBRL DOCUMENT v3.19.3.a.u2
SHARE-BASED COMPENSATION - Other Options Disclosures (Details) -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
12 Months Ended
Dec. 31, 2019
Dec. 31, 2018
Dec. 31, 2017
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Upon vesting, period to exercise in years 4 years    
Fair value per share upon grant (in dollars per share) $ 0 $ 0 $ 4
Number of options granted (in shares) 0 0 686
Intrinsic value per share upon exercise (in dollars per share) $ 7.06 $ 7.33 $ 7.24
Intrinsic value of options exercised $ 1,272 $ 829 $ 60
Tax benefit from options exercised 73 220 21
Cash received from exercise price of options exercised $ 244 $ 153 $ 42
Minimum      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Exercise price range of options issued (in dollars per share) $ 1.34 $ 1.34 $ 1.34
Upon vesting, period to exercise in years 1 year 1 year 1 year
Maximum      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Exercise price range of options issued (in dollars per share) $ 1.34 $ 2.02 $ 11.31
Upon vesting, period to exercise in years 10 years 10 years 10 years